Update: Name of actor released after tragic fall in the Drakensberg

He fell over 40 metres to the bottom of the waterfall, which has rocks and a small pool of water

Police have released the name of the actor who tragically fell to his death on Thursday (April 12).

The deceased has been identified as 39-year-old Odwa Shweni, who is from Centurion.

Winterton detectives have opened an inquest.

It is believed that Shweni, who was shooting an action scene for a movie at the time, lost his footing at the top of the Sterkspruit Waterfall, which is at Monks Cowl in the Drakensberg.

The waterfall was at full flow due to recent rains.

The actor fell over 40 metres to the bottom of the waterfall, which has rocks and a small pool of water.

Search & Rescue members from Pietermaritzburg and Empangeni, and Chief Freddie Halgreen (Okhahlamba Fire & Emergency Services) were at the scene.

The man’s body was recovered just before 11am on Friday (April 13) at the bottom of the falls between the rocks.
